Output 07da3cfa666dfdf45213698d8cdfc6e450fbc3024a0fcf08d7e6cec1341d5207:20

value
8830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04d9a358be0e841f77428dd91eb8c951d0e7aa6c OP_EQUAL
address
9rsv5v3t19ym64Wb65X2pymmEbDtS5dbSt
transaction
07da3cfa666dfdf45213698d8cdfc6e450fbc3024a0fcf08d7e6cec1341d5207